If you are looking for an academic debating society, this Philosophy Group is not for you! Members are expected to have an interest in current moral and ethical issues, for example, rather than detailed knowledge of classical philosophy.
At each month's meeting a topic is introduced by an individual member. Typically, this takes the form of a briefing paper, which has been circulated ahead of the meeting, and is then the subject of a chaired discussion.
It is hoped, therefore, that at some point, each member will contribute to the Group's activities in this way.
Some of the themes presented this year include: Pacifism, Euthanasia, The Rule of Law, Reading Books, Heroism, Should Philosophy Be Taught in Schools?, Drug Use or Abuse, Truth, Are We a Cult? The range is eclectic!
